KLC75T was operating from EHAM to ENVA on 2026-09-04. SkyMeter detected a long landing rollout at Trondheim Airport Værnes (ENVA) on runway 27 at 14:25 UTC. Trace data at the event: 0 ft AGL, 5 kt GS, 0 fpm vertical. Approach stability score: 85/100. Scores in this band are observed on roughly 50% of approaches at this runway and represent the centerline of normal operations. METAR at the time reported 10 kt wind, 5 kt crosswind component, 9,994 m visibility. A long landing rollout is detected when ground deceleration after touchdown is below the per-runway P10 envelope. It is an observational measure of rollout efficiency, not a runway-exit incident. Detection algorithm and known limitations: see SkyMeter methodology.
